Shear Stress induced at Radius 'r' from Center of Shaft Solution

STEP 0: Pre-Calculation Summary
Formula Used
Shear Stress in Shaft = (Shear Stress at Radius r*Radius from Center to Distance r)/Radius of Shaft
τ = (Tr*r)/R
This formula uses 4 Variables
Variables Used
Shear Stress in Shaft - (Measured in Pascal) - Shear Stress in Shaft is when a shaft is subjected to torque or twisting shearing stress is produced in the shaft.
Shear Stress at Radius r - (Measured in Pascal) - Shear Stress at Radius r from shaft is a force tending to cause deformation of a material by slippage along a plane or planes parallel to the imposed stress.
Radius from Center to Distance r - (Measured in Meter) - The Radius from Center to Distance r of the shaft is a radial line from the focus to any point of a curve.
Radius of Shaft - (Measured in Meter) - The Radius of Shaft is the line segment extending from the center of a circle or sphere to the circumference or bounding surface.

What is Torsional Force?

A Torsion Force is a load that is applied to material through torque. The torque that is applied creates shear stress. If a torsion force is large enough, it can cause a material to undergo a twisting motion during elastic and plastic deformation.

What is Shear Stress?

Shear Stress, force tending to cause deformation of a material by slippage along a plane or planes parallel to the imposed stress.
